Output 41e332068bc4eea9f0df7f1ba09618318994d4237031fd3d933c6d17259d7674:0

value
1010936
script pubkey
OP_0 OP_PUSHBYTES_20 bbf1bf33eecebd9eaab751d32e1e43c95c10835a
address
bc1qh0cm7vlwe67ea24h28fju8jre9wppq66e8xuyc
transaction
41e332068bc4eea9f0df7f1ba09618318994d4237031fd3d933c6d17259d7674
confirmations
56334
spent
true